Lancaster's real estate market demonstrates steady appreciation with inventory suitable for first-time buyers. The median home price ranges from $350,000-$450,000, offering value compared to coastal California markets. New construction developments provide move-in-ready options with modern amenities. The market shows strong buyer interest from young families and professionals relocating from pricier areas. Local economic growth driven by aerospace, healthcare, and retail sectors supports property values. Days on market typically range from 30-45 days, indicating balanced conditions favoring informed buyers.

First-time buyer homes in Lancaster range from $300,000-$550,000 depending on size and location. New construction typically starts around $350,000. Resale homes offer more variety at competitive prices. Properties with modern updates and efficient layouts command premium pricing. Neighborhoods closer to downtown and schools tend toward higher price points within the market.

First-time buyers in Lancaster should get pre-approved for financing before house hunting to strengthen offers. Attend open houses in desired neighborhoods to understand local market conditions. Consider properties in up-and-coming areas offering better value appreciation potential. Budget for homeowner's insurance, property taxes, and HOA fees beyond mortgage payments. Work with local real estate agents familiar with Lancaster's neighborhoods and development patterns for expert guidance.

Lancaster spans diverse neighborhoods each with distinct character and amenities. The Westside features newer master-planned communities with parks and retail. Downtown Lancaster offers revitalized areas with shopping and dining options. North Lancaster provides family-friendly residential areas near excellent schools. The Eastside includes more affordable options and growing commercial development. Rosamond Boulevard corridor boasts improved infrastructure and commercial expansion. Each neighborhood offers unique advantages while maintaining the city's affordable housing advantage.
